Insights
This case highlights a rare instance of pyomyositis, a bacterial muscle infection, co-occurring with septic pulmonary emboli in a child. Early diagnosis and treatment are crucial for improving outcomes in such complex pediatric infections.

Background:
- Pyomyositis, a bacterial skeletal muscle infection, is typically caused by Staphylococcus aureus and predominantly affects children and immunocompromised individuals.
- Prompt diagnosis and management are essential for favorable prognoses in pediatric infectious conditions.
Observation:
- An 8-year-old girl presented with confusion, fever, and right knee swelling post-trauma.
- Imaging revealed potential pulmonary bleeding, later diagnosed as septic pulmonary emboli, and a knee abscess consistent with pyomyositis.
- Blood cultures confirmed Staphylococcus aureus infection.
Findings:
- The case illustrates a rare association between pyomyositis and septic pulmonary emboli in a pediatric patient.
- Magnetic resonance imaging (MRI) confirmed abscess formation in the affected extremity, aligning with pyomyositis progression.
Implications:
- This case underscores the importance of maintaining a high index of suspicion for pyomyositis and septic pulmonary emboli in children presenting with relevant symptoms.
- Early therapeutic intervention in pediatric cases with combined muscle and pulmonary findings can significantly enhance patient prognosis.
Abstract:
Pyomyositis is a suppurative infection of skeletal muscle most commonly caused by Staphylococcus aureus. It is mainly encountered in children and immunocompromised. Eight year old previously healthy girl presented with confusion, fever and swelling of the right knee two days after a trauma. Abdominal ultrasonography and computerized tomography taken upon development of hematemesis revealed no pathology in the abdomen, but potential bleeding sites in lung sections. Thorax CT images were interpreted in favor of septic pulmonary emboli due to the presence of peripheral nodular consolidation areas with central cavitation, mostly pathchy in medial areas. S. aureus was isolated in the blood culture. At the end of third week of hospitalization, gadolinium enhanced contrast MRI of right extremity was taken to evaluate right extremity swelling and revealed abscess formation as expected in the clinical progress of pyomyositis. Pyomyositis and septic pulmonary emboli are a rare association. This case demonstrates that the high index of suspicion in pediatric cases with muscle findings and septic pulmonary findings and early institution of therapy may improve the prognosis.
